Method
Fish Marinade
- 1
Prepare the Marinade
In a bowl, whisk together olive oil, lime juice, minced garlic, ground cumin, paprika, salt, black pepper, and chopped cilantro.
- 2
Marinate the Fish
Place the fish fillets in a shallow dish and pour the marinade over them. Ensure the fish is well-co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.

Soup (optional)
- 7
Prepare the Soup
In a large pot, combine vegetable broth, sliced carrots, celery, chopped onion, minced garlic, bay leaf, salt, and black pepper. Bring to a boil.
- 8
Simmer the Soup
Reduce heat to low and let the soup simmer for 20-25 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ender. Stir in fresh parsley before serving.
